About Mathematical Horizons For Quantum Physics

Quantum theory is one of the most important intellectual developments in the early twentieth century. This volume arose from a two-month workshop held at the Institute for Mathematical Sciences at the National University of Singapore in July-September 2008 on mathematical physics, focusing specifically on operator algebras in quantum theory.
